From Drafting and Release: The Workflow of Artificial Intelligence Article Creation
Current world of content production is fast transforming, and Artificial Intelligence is in the forefront. Traditionally, crafting a engaging article required significant research, detailed outlining, with protracted writing and editing processes. However, AI-driven tools are transforming this workflow, permitting authors to generate high-quality articles more efficiently. The process typically begins with developing a thorough outline, which tools can aid by proposing topics, keywords, and even headings. Following, the tool can generate a rough draft, giving a foundation for writer editing. Crucially, AI aren't meant to replace authors, but rather to improve their abilities. The stage entails careful editing to guarantee precision, lucidity, and a authentic tone before publication. With embracing AI, creators can optimize their workflow, focus on creative aspects, and produce outstanding articles consistently.

Upholding Text Assessment for AI Articles: Editing & Fact-Checking Best Practices
Considering the fast expansion of AI-generated articles, comprehensive quality control is highly essential than ever. Merely generating copyright isn’t enough; confirming accuracy, readability, and general quality is vital. Effective AI article quality control involves a layered approach, merging both automated tools and human review. To begin, focus on identifying factual inaccuracies through careful fact-checking. It involves confirming claims against reputable sources and cross-referencing information across several platforms. After fact-checking, concentrate on editing for grammar, voice, and coherence. Pay attention to sentence structure, ensuring smooth transitions and captivating prose. Finally, evaluate the overall quality of the piece, looking for possible biases, copying, and any other issues that could affect its trustworthiness. Establishing these best practices will help you deliver high-quality, correct, and captivating AI-generated articles.
Concerning AI Content Farms & The Fight Against Substandard Online Articles
Currently, a growing trend of AI content farms has surfaced, generating vast quantities of articles with the primary goal of capturing search engine traffic. These “farms” employ artificial intelligence to rapidly create content, often prioritizing sheer numbers over quality. The result is a wave of articles that are typically poorly written, lacking originality, and filled with factual inaccuracies. This increase of low-quality content not only diminishes the overall user experience but also presents a significant challenge for search engines attempting to provide relevant and trustworthy information. Experts are increasingly concerned about the impact of these AI-generated articles on the credibility of online content and the ability of users to locate reliable sources. The struggle against these farms is ongoing, with search engines implementing new algorithms and strategies to pinpoint and penalize low-quality content. Eventually, the goal is to reestablish a more trustworthy and informative online landscape, where high-quality content is rewarded and low-quality, AI-generated fluff is eliminated.
